## Alert: Currency Conversion Rounding Drift (Pennywhistle)

This alert triggers when the Pennywhistle ledger detects cumulative rounding drift above 0.50 units in any currency pair over a 24-hour window. Small per-transaction discrepancies are expected; sustained drift usually means a rate table was loaded with truncated precision. Do not adjust ledger entries manually. Record the affected pair and window, then report the incident to the reconciliation team at the address below.

pager mailbox: druwyn@norvaio.corp

## Service Accounts — StormFan Alert Fan-Out

The fan-out worker authenticates to the internal dispatch tier using the svc-stormfan account. Rotate quarterly; scopes are limited to publish-only on alert topics. If deliveries stall during your shift, verify the worker is using the current credential, reproduced below for reference.

API key for kaweg-hahif: kto4_rAjZ

Undo/redo in Sketchloom is snapshot-based — every canvas change lands in the history ring, capped by HISTORY_DEPTH. If redo feels flaky locally, you probably haven't wired up the history store. Grab the sample env from the repo root, set HISTORY_DEPTH=200, and drop the history store credential on the line right after.

sealed setting: ARCHIVE_KEY3=8d0